Novelist Chimamanda Ngozi Adichie chooses a portrait by the 20th Century Nigerian artist Ben Enwonwu, called Tutu. Plus additional archive including Ben Enwonwu talking to the ÃÛÑ¿´«Ã½ in 1958, poet Jackie Kay on African art, the artist Edosa Oguigo, and more from Chimamanda.
